Subject: Quickstore 4.2 — bloom filter now fronts the KV layer

Plugin authors: starting with this release, Quickstore places a bloom filter ahead of the key-value store. Negative lookups return faster; false positives fall through safely. No API changes are required on your side. Verify your plugin against the staging build referenced below.

session token of fahif-tadup = htk3_9c7

Action item: The Relayn deploy-status bot silently dropped updates when the pipeline API paginated results, so responders believed a rollback had completed when it had not. We will add pagination handling, a staleness banner, and an integration test. Until merged, verify deploy state directly in the pipeline console, documented at the page below.

runbook for kahop-kajop: https://rundeck.ordinio.test/display/secrets/pipeline/issue/pages/repo/browse/e5732776e07d1285107e5aeb

- [ ] **Offline mode — Meadowtrack field-survey app:** Verify surveys created offline sync correctly once connectivity returns, including photo attachments. Support should confirm the sync banner appears and clears on its own. If a customer reports stuck syncs, ask them to read out the token shown on the diagnostics screen.

pipeline stamp: htk9_ce63042d9